Current Landscape of Steel Piping in South Korea

Analyzing the intersection of metallurgical excellence and regional industrial requirements.

South Korea's industrial sector is characterized by a heavy reliance on high-performance materials. The demand for large metal pipe systems is driven primarily by the nation's world-leading shipbuilding and offshore engineering sectors, where structural integrity under extreme marine pressure is non-negotiable.

Geographically, the peninsula's coastal environment necessitates advanced anti-corrosion coatings and specific alloy compositions. The prevalence of high-salinity air in port cities like Busan requires a round metal pipe design that minimizes weld points and maximizes surface uniformity to prevent premature oxidation.

Economically, the shift towards "Smart Factories" and the "K-New Deal" has pivoted the market toward high-precision metal tube pipe components that integrate seamlessly with automated assembly lines, reducing waste and enhancing the efficiency of semiconductor and automotive manufacturing.

Market Development History

In the 1970s and 80s, the South Korean market focused on heavy industrialization, relying on massive, thick-walled carbon steel pipes for basic infrastructure and primary steel mills. The priority was raw strength and bulk availability over precision.

Between 1990 and 2010, the industry transitioned toward specialized metallurgy. The rise of the global automotive and electronics sectors sparked a demand for lightweight metal pipe options, introducing high-strength low-alloy (HSLA) steels and advanced cold-rolling techniques.

From 2010 to the present, the focus has shifted to sustainability and extreme precision. The implementation of Laser-Beam Welding (LBW) and CNC-controlled forming has allowed for the creation of complex, thin-walled structures that maintain high structural rigidity.

Future Development Trends

Integration of Smart Sensing

Future piping will integrate embedded IoT sensors to monitor structural health and flow rates in real-time, reducing maintenance costs for urban utilities.

Hydrogen-Ready Materials

With Korea's push for a hydrogen economy, there is a surging trend toward specialized alloys that prevent hydrogen embrittlement in high-pressure transmission lines.

Carbon-Neutral Manufacturing

The transition to "Green Steel" produced via electric arc furnaces (EAF) will become the standard to meet strict ESG requirements and global carbon tariffs.
